What are the responsibilities and job description for the Pharmacy Delivery Driver position at Solaris Hospice?
Company Overview:
Solaris is clinician owned and operated and has been recognized as industry experts in palliative medicine, since 1998. We are committed to helping patients and their families always put life first.
Responsibilities:
- Reviews and verifies accuracy of delivery manifests (sheet(s)/tickets) and other office documentation. In collaboration with Pharmacy staff prioritizes items for delivery.
- Professionally drives vehicle for pick-up and delivery services.
- Delivers items to specific locations according to priority requests from Pharmacy personnel.
- Provides Pharmacy Delivery Services by ensuring prompt and accurate distribution of medications and supplies to Solaris offices and medical care providers in accordance with customer demand and the requirements of the assigned route
- Provides timely and accurate completion of deliveries to Solaris Pharmacy customers while using the most safe and efficient delivery routes.
- Maintains company vehicles and equipment (if applicable) in proper working condition and performs minor roadside repairs. May have company vehicle repaired when approved by Pharmacy Director or his/her appointee.
- Performs general pharmacy clean up, including vacuuming, breaking down boxes, disposal of trash and general custodial type work as scheduled or upon request of pharmacy personnel.
- Assists pharmacy personnel by restocking supplies, containers, bottles, etc. on request.
Qualifications and Requirements:
- Ability to communicate via phone effectively, professionally, and courteously, fax, written, or face-to-face with all contacts and staff
- Exhibit proficient computer skills
- A valid Texas driver’s license
- A current and maintained safe driving record
- Ability to read and follow written and verbal routing directions
- Ability to read and write record information as directed
- Prefer computer knowledge in Microsoft Office Products
Company vehicle is provided.
